diff --git a/src/api/java/FuncInterp.java b/src/api/java/FuncInterp.java index fb549b3f2..72f6bb25d 100644 --- a/src/api/java/FuncInterp.java +++ b/src/api/java/FuncInterp.java @@ -83,7 +83,7 @@ public class FuncInterp extends Z3Object return res + getValue() + "]"; } catch (Z3Exception e) { - return new String("Z3Exception: " + e.getMessage()); + return "Z3Exception: " + e.getMessage(); } } @@ -105,7 +105,7 @@ public class FuncInterp extends Z3Object getContext().getFuncEntryDRQ().add(o); super.decRef(o); } - }; + } /** * The number of entries in the function interpretation. @@ -186,7 +186,7 @@ public class FuncInterp extends Z3Object return res; } catch (Z3Exception e) { - return new String("Z3Exception: " + e.getMessage()); + return "Z3Exception: " + e.getMessage(); } } diff --git a/src/api/java/Statistics.java b/src/api/java/Statistics.java index de5a52ebb..051912468 100644 --- a/src/api/java/Statistics.java +++ b/src/api/java/Statistics.java @@ -90,7 +90,7 @@ public class Statistics extends Z3Object return Key + ": " + getValueString(); } catch (Z3Exception e) { - return new String("Z3Exception: " + e.getMessage()); + return "Z3Exception: " + e.getMessage(); } } diff --git a/src/api/java/Symbol.java b/src/api/java/Symbol.java index b90f8d915..60b60dbdf 100644 --- a/src/api/java/Symbol.java +++ b/src/api/java/Symbol.java @@ -72,11 +72,10 @@ public class Symbol extends Z3Object else if (isStringSymbol()) return ((StringSymbol) this).getString(); else - return new String( - "Z3Exception: Unknown symbol kind encountered."); + return "Z3Exception: Unknown symbol kind encountered."; } catch (Z3Exception ex) { - return new String("Z3Exception: " + ex.getMessage()); + return "Z3Exception: " + ex.getMessage(); } }